Output d7afcc960b85c53bbb93f48aac58f1087e405850d18b30498e2f3376a51cc530:1

value
312508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52ea296f0b9f077a403185023430b32c43660211 OP_EQUAL
address
39FRr8Awk7wLYFunXnVS5qd2EE3TsEmV8f
transaction
d7afcc960b85c53bbb93f48aac58f1087e405850d18b30498e2f3376a51cc530